Output ebcd50387338984c43a65c57d18d5d7c612333c59ef8c220a3f2d11d5b09842a:0
- value
- 588026
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e282f65048812342b4216ef9611881cf2ebd2e0 OP_EQUAL
- address
- 37MfxYpNDBuRA9owaGg9ajP4gK5Fqn1Et8
- transaction
- ebcd50387338984c43a65c57d18d5d7c612333c59ef8c220a3f2d11d5b09842a
- confirmations
- 253562
- spent
- true